Luxbox has secured international sales rights for Dénes Nagy's upcoming film, "The Vacation." This collaboration reunites the Paris-based company with Nagy and his long-time producers at Campfilm, following their successful partnership on the award-winning "Natural Light." The film is set to be showcased at the 23rd Berlinale Co-Production Market, from February 14 to 17, as one of 35 projects seeking finance and partners.
Set in 2021, "The Vacation" centers on Feci, a Hungarian cattle farm worker, and his wife Klara, as they embark on an organized tour of the South of France. This trip takes them outside their comfort zone, marking their first time flying. A chance encounter with more experienced travelers leads to unexpected challenges when Feci must quarantine due to a COVID-19 test mix-up, leading him on a solitary, transformative journey through Provencal monasteries while Klara explores with her new acquaintances.
